Atlantic Surf Clams and/or Cockle Clams (May Contain Traces of Shellfish and Fish), Wheat Flour, Soybean Oil, Yellow Corn Flour, Bleached Wheat Flour, Water, Modified Wheat Starch, Contains Less than 2% of the Following: Salt, Leavening (Sodium Acid Pyro Phosphate, Baking Soda), Sodium Tripolyphosphate, Dextrose, Whey (a Milk Derivative), Yeast, Calcium Caseinate (a Milk Derivative), Sodium Alginate, Soy Flour, Natural Flavor, Caramelized Sugar, Maltodextrin, Extractives of Paprika.
Cooking Instructions: For food safety, quality, and thorough cooking, please follow the instructions below. Keep frozen until ready to prepare. Product is not ready to eat until fully cooked to an internal temperature of 165 degrees F. Microwaving not recommended. Conventional Oven: Preheat oven to 425 degrees F. Arrange frozen clam strips in a single layer on baking sheet and place on middle rack of oven. For half package, bake 16-17 minutes. For full package, bake 19-20 minutes. For best results, turn product over half way through cooking. Toaster Oven: Preheat oven to 400 degrees F. Arrange frozen clam strips in a single layer on baking sheet. For 2 servings (6 ounces), bake 13-14 minutes. For best results, turn product over half way through cooking. Home Fryer: Preheat fryer oil to 350 degrees F. Place frozen clam strips in fry basket. For half package, fry 80-90 seconds. Drain on absorbent paper before serving. Air Fryer: Preheat air fryer to 375 degrees F. Arrange frozen clam strips in a single layer in basket. For 2 servings (6 ounces), cook 7-8 minutes. Due to differences in appliances, cooking times may vary & require adjustment. Caution: Product will be hot!
